Continuing a Legacy of Safety: Eldorado Gold Lamaque Wins the 2017 F.J. O’Connell Trophy

Frank J. O’Connell is somewhat of a legend in Canadian mining circles. Passionate about workplace safety, he helped set the standard for underground mine safety in Quebec during the 1950’s.
